AEW Rampage Rating Ticks Up, Viewership Down Slightly
Image Credit: AEW
Last week’s episode of AEW Rampage saw the rating rise a bit, while the overall viewership was slightly down. Wrestlenomics’ Brandon Thurston reports that Friday’s show drew a 0.17 rating in the 18 – 49 demographic and 428,000 viewers. Those numbers are up 21.4% and down 1.6% respectively from the previous week’s 0.14 demo rating and 435,000 viewers.
Rampage had its best rating since the April 22nd episode drew a 0.19, while the audience was exactly even with the number from two weeks ago. Rampage ranked #6 among cable originals for the night per Showbuzz DailY, with HGTV’s My Lottery Dream Home scoring #1 on cable with a 0.2 demo rating and 1.489 million viewers.
Rampage is averaging a 0.174 demo rating and 471,000 viewers in 2022 to date.
